『壹』 一般我們做Javaweb項目如果要做許可權管理模塊的話都需要用後台框架,如果用原生的servlet應該怎麼做呢
用Filter搞。配置一個過濾器先,做一個許可權表再,許可權依據為每項功能的url和用戶/用戶組,用戶請求結合session和當前的url,來決定是否放行功能。如此一來,簡單的許可權需求已經可以適應了。、
http://www.oschina.net/question/222919_61496
『貳』 javaweb 項目的系統許可權管理,怎麼設計
用戶表,角色表,許可權表。用戶關聯角色,例如會員,超級會員,管理員。角色關聯許可權,例如增刪查改。
『叄』 怎麼在java web 上實現智能餐飲管理系統 連
1.前台營業:日常營業操作
日始日結:設定每個營業日的開始和結束
接待預訂:顯示餐桌狀態,進行訂餐
點菜收銀:開台、點菜、結賬、交班,提供最主要的營業功能
2.營業設置:日常營業所必需的資料庫設定
酒菜設置:按類別(酒水飲料、冷盤、熱菜、主食、包桌、服務用品等)設置酒菜數據;
房台設置:類別設置包房或餐台;
其他設置:付款方式(現金、銀行卡、贈券、掛賬、免單)、點菜說明等
3.賬務查詢:查詢各類單據和消費情況
賬單查詢:查詢所有已結賬單
點單查詢:查詢所有歷史點單
掛賬查詢:查詢掛賬(簽單)客人消費情況
4.輔助管理:日常營業所需的其他管理功能
操作員管理:管理操作員信息,並設置系統操作許可權和最低折扣值
掛賬管理:掛賬人信息錄入、修改、掛賬歸還
邏輯結構設計:
1、員工(員工編號,姓名,性別,出生日期,政治面貌,學歷,身份證號,聯系電話,聯系地址,員工狀態,員工職務,薪水,入職日期,備注)
2、酒菜表(酒菜編號,酒菜名稱,單價,各類,備注)
3、消費單(消費單號,餐桌號,折扣,付賬方式,結賬日期,賬單金額,顧客人數,掛賬人編號,收銀員編號)
4、點單(點單號,消費單號,菜號,酒菜數量)
5、訂單(訂單編號,訂單人,身份證號,餐桌號,訂金,聯系電話,訂餐日期,時間,備注)
6、餐桌表(餐桌號,各類,狀態,容量,服務員號)
7、掛賬人信息(編號,掛賬人名,身份證,聯系電話,聯系地址,注冊時間)
8、操作員表(編號,用戶名,密碼,用戶許可權,員工編號)
『肆』 java 中怎麼做許可權系統的控制和分配
下面是一個java的web許可權管理模塊的應用與實現。
先介紹數據模型和應用界面,後繼對實現細節做選擇性闡述。
數據表關系如下:
該圖標明了登陸用戶、角色、部門(機構)、用戶組、角色和模塊功能之間的關系。為方便起見,所有表都只保留必要欄位。
在本系統設計中,如下概念有著相對特殊的含義。
一、用戶(user): 系統的使用者。
二、部門(org):體現了用戶的行政關系,
三、組(group) :是某相同職能的用戶的集合,可以和用戶一樣與角色產生關聯。設置組的目的是為了方便用戶的角色分配,減少用戶與角色的直接對應關系。用戶的角色可以是其組角色和其直接分配的角色之合集。限於作者的時間和精力,組功能在該系統中沒有具體的實現。
四、角色(role):角色對應著某些功能(function)的集合,被分配一個角色意味著有權執行這些功能。角色表中的欄位"functions"記錄相關的功能id,id之間用逗號隔開。
五、功能(function):系統的一個或者多個執行准入。
『伍』 如何使用java web製作超市賬單管理系統
許可權可以使用的那件---
「的作用----」許可權來解決一個用戶可以擁有多個角色,如座位一般工作人員的作用。李四的普通員工和人員的作用。
角色可以有多個許可權,如一般工作人員可以登錄,更改密碼,查看部分,管理人員可以查看庫存,采購的商品。
許可是對應於一個特定的功能,如的登陸許可權密碼許可權查看產品的許可權,采購權,如各種功能的許可權。
出現這種情況,當一個用戶登錄必要的調查,他不落地許可,可能會被禁止降落。著陸後,你可以檢查出他的角色,許可權,每個角色對應不同的操作,在他的時代,這是必要的檢查,他沒有許可權就行了。
『陸』 javaweb應用系統,求一套許可權管理源代碼,不同角色勾選不同菜單,擁有對應菜單許可權不一樣!
代碼沒有寫出起來,給你說一下原理吧!許可權主要分為用戶角色菜單一個角色對應多個用戶,多個角色對應多個菜單這樣用戶登錄時可以通過用戶自己的角色得到相應的菜單而菜單就直接關繫到具體的功能操作了這樣就劃分出許可權了比如每個人都有自己的名字如「1,2,3,4」而用戶可能有同樣的角色如:「1,2是管理員」「3,4是主任」這樣的管理員和主任就是角色這兩個角色的權利(許可權)當然不同了這樣就是許可權管理了啊中文java技術網
『柒』 java web的用戶角色許可權管理是如何實現的
用戶許可權管理一般是用servlet的過濾器來實現的。
過濾器會過濾訪問相關資源(這個是在web.xml裡面配置的)的請求。
如果樓主要實現防止未登錄用戶訪問相關資源。只要在過濾器里判斷該用戶是否登錄,也就是樓主所說的session中的用戶狀態屬性。是登陸的則放行,否則拒絕。
過濾器的用法就不在這里寫了,網上很多的。
不知能否解決樓主的問題呢?
『捌』 javaweb 項目的系統許可權管理,怎麼設計
按你說的設計可以啊,設置角色,給用戶分配角色,角色控制菜單顯示,最好做一個後台可以編輯角色,那樣方便很多
『玖』 java web開發多用戶博客系統,用戶許可權控制該怎麼實現
資料庫設計,設計如下:
用戶:user
角色:role
用戶-角色:user_role
資源:resource(包括上級菜單、子菜單、按鈕等資源)
角色-資源:role_resource
標準的許可權管理系統設計為以上5張表。
註:用戶、用戶-角色我就不做說明了,這兩個是很簡單的兩塊,用戶的crud,以及為用戶分配角色(多對多的關系)稍微琢磨一下就清楚了,下面都是針對為角色分配許可權的實現
後台實現
展示層採用ztree樹